Secret Maryo Chronicles

Secret Maryo Chronicles is a free and open-source two-dimensional platform computer game that began in 2003.[1] The game has been described by the German PCtipp as a Super Mario Bros. clone.[2]

History

Version 2 of Secret Maryo Chronicles

Secret Maryo Chronicles began as a SourceForge project in January 2003.[3] It was developed and is maintained by the Secret Maryo Chronicles development team, led by Florian Richter ("FluXy").[4] The game is OpenGL-based and has an original soundtrack and a built-in game editor. It has been released under the GNU General Public License, Version 3.[5] The game has been expanded up the latest release in 2009.[3] A continuation called The Secret Chronicles of Dr. M. (TSC) is as of April 2017 under continued development.[6]

Reception

Secret Maryo Chronicles was listed as the number one open source video game by APC in January 2008.[1] The game was named one of the most promising open source games of 2008 by El Heraldo.[7] In 2008, Stern praised the speed of the game and its puzzle solving,[8] and heute praised SMC as a well-made non-violent game for children.[9] SMC was selected in March 2009 as "HotPick" by Linux Format.[10] An in-detail review of the Free software magazine in 2015 called the game a "great way to procrastinate".[11]

SMC became a popular freeware titled offered by many freeware download outlets; the game was downloaded over 3.4 million times just via Sourceforge.net between 2004 and May 2017.[12]
